**CI note: Cron-to-Wharfline migration issues**

Support team: we're moving legacy cron jobs onto the Wharfline workflow engine in batches. During cutover, some jobs may run twice within one window — this is expected and idempotent. If a customer reports a missed run entirely, check the migration batch log using the trace token below.

pipeline stamp: htk9_ce63042d9

Subject: Quickstore 4.2 — bloom filter now fronts the KV layer

Plugin authors: starting with this release, Quickstore places a bloom filter ahead of the key-value store. Negative lookups return faster; false positives fall through safely. No API changes are required on your side. Verify your plugin against the staging build referenced below.

session token of fahif-tadup = htk3_9c7

## Environment variables for Coinwright integration tests

Hey plugin folks — if your test suite against the Coinwright payments sandbox is flaky, it's almost always environment setup, not our API. The most common culprit: the sandbox ledger resets hourly, and tests that cache account state across that boundary will fail randomly. Set COINWRIGHT_LEDGER_PIN=true to pin a snapshot. You'll also need the sandbox credential loaded before the suite starts, so make sure your env file includes this line:

sealed setting: LEDGER_TOKEN13=5d842615a26d7

Welcome to on-call for the Glimmerpane design system! Our snapshot tests live in the `snapcheck` suite and run on every merge to main. If a UI component changes visually, the diff bot flags it — usually it's an intentional tweak, so just approve the new baseline. If it's 2am and snapshots are failing across the board, it's almost always a font-loading race, not your problem. To unlock the baseline store and re-approve snapshots in bulk, use the recovery passphrase below.

recovery phrase for tahag-taguf: wenix-caswyn